T-shirts, tacos, and tourism: Singapore cashes in on Trump-Kim mania
 
 SINGAPORE: From summit-themed burgers and online scalpers peddling World Peace medallions and Peace Out from Lion City T-shirts, Singaporeans are cashing in on a historic meeting between US President Donald Trump and North Koreas Kim Jong Un.
